Today we have a little trickle-down film economics going on as Django Unchained appears to have boosted the profile of a DTV-tier western Wesley Snipes shot more than five years ago. From director Andrew Goth comes Gallowwalkers, which pits Snipes against a horde of resurrected bad guys in an vaguely cool-sounding feature. I give the credit to Django, but perhaps there’s another reason this particular bloody western has been plucked from purgatory after half a decade for a cheap VOD release?
GALLOWWALKERS is the story of a mysterious gunman, Aman (Snipes), the son of a nun, who breaks her covenant with God to ensure his survival. Her break with God curses her son to be hunted by all those who die by his hand – When he takes revenge on a gang that murdered his love, the gang rises as a cursed crew of undead warriors and hunt him mercilessly, seeking their ‘dying’ revenge.
That’s not a bad premise, and the newest trailer suggests that the film might have a little visual flair along with all the blood.
I’m interested to hear some reactions to this, even if it would seem to be garbage getting cheaply recycled to VOD to cash in on the zeitgeist. The film will likely hit VOD sooner rather than later, as it has been picked up by Wreckin Hill, distributor of Dark Tide and Morgan Spurlock’s ComicCon movie.
